RedEx eSIM does not provide a truly unlimited high‑speed data plan for Asia. All plans that carry the “Unlimited” name give a fixed amount of high‑speed data – most examples range from 1 GB to 3 GB – after which the speed is reduced to a low throttled rate such as 384 kbps or 128 kbps. For travelers who need larger data volumes, RedEx offers fixed‑data plans like the 100 GB plan valid for 365 days, which gives a stable high‑speed allowance without speed throttling after the data cap is reached. These larger fixed‑data options may be more cost‑effective for heavy data users in Asia.
RedEx eSIM offers an Asia eSIM plan that includes a phone number and SMS capability. The available plan is 20 GB of data for 30 days at a price of $35.89 USD. It supplies a local phone number that can receive and make calls and can send and receive SMS messages. The plan’s dialing code is +61, indicating the phone number is issued from Australia, and it covers a wide range of Asian countries such as China, Hong Kong, Indonesia, Japan, Cambodia, South Korea, Macau, Malaysia, Philippines, Singapore, Thailand, Taiwan, and Vietnam, with a few additional countries outside Asia also included. Users who need a specific dialing code or have special requirements should confirm the details directly with RedEx eSIM.
